首页
/ Gosec安全工具版本升级修复关键问题分析

Gosec安全工具版本升级修复关键问题分析

2025-05-28 23:00:38作者:舒璇辛Bertina

背景概述

Gosec作为Go语言静态代码分析工具,在保障Go项目安全性方面发挥着重要作用。近期该项目完成了重要版本更新,主要针对依赖库中的安全问题进行了修复。

问题详情

在最新发布的v2.22.0版本中,Gosec解决了两个关键依赖库的安全问题:

  1. golang.org/x/crypto:该加密库先前版本存在严重问题(Critical级别),可能影响加密操作的安全性。新版本更新后确保了加密算法的正确实现。

  2. golang.org/x/net:网络库先前版本存在高危问题(High级别),可能影响网络通信的安全性。版本更新后修复了潜在的协议实现缺陷。

技术影响分析

这些底层库的安全更新对Gosec工具本身及其用户项目都具有重要意义:

  • 工具链安全性提升:确保静态分析工具本身不会成为安全短板
  • 间接保护用户项目:通过更新依赖关系,避免将已知问题传递给用户项目
  • 构建过程更安全:修复可能影响CI/CD流水线的潜在风险

升级建议

对于使用Gosec的开发团队,建议采取以下措施:

  1. 立即升级至v2.22.0或更高版本
  2. 检查项目中是否直接或间接依赖这些库
  3. 更新CI/CD配置中的Gosec版本
  4. 重新扫描项目以确保所有安全警告基于最新问题数据库

版本兼容性

新版本保持向后兼容,升级过程平滑。主要变更集中在依赖项更新,核心功能接口保持不变,用户无需修改现有配置即可获得安全增强。

总结

Gosec团队快速响应安全问题的态度值得赞赏。作为安全工具的使用者,及时跟进此类更新是保障项目安全的重要环节。建议所有Go开发者关注此类安全工具的版本更新,将其纳入常规的安全维护流程中。

登录后查看全文
热门项目推荐
相关项目推荐